Intellinetics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Intellinetics, Inc is a provider of enterprise content management and digital transformation solutions designed to help organizations streamline document-centric processes and improve operational efficiency. The company’s platform enables clients to capture, store, manage and retrieve both paper and electronic records through a unified system, reducing reliance on manual workflows and minimizing the risks associated with paper-based information handling.

The company offers a range of software products and professional services aimed at automating business processes and ensuring secure, compliant access to critical data.
